If something goes wrong with your home, you'll need to fix it. So many aspects of a house make it livable. You need a roof to keep out the rain, and working pipes to carry water to various parts of your home. But if something happens with these aspects, we don't always have the money to fix it. That's where home improvement loans come in. These loans are tailor made for the purpose of fixing your house. Whether it's an emergency or cosmetic, you may need this kind of help. Luckily, you can get free home improvement loans quotes to help you figure out how much money you qualify for.

Free home improvement loans quotes are very important. You should use these free online calculators before you do any planning in regards to the home improvement. So many people think that they will qualify for more money than they actually do. When you use free home improvement loans quote calculators, you will have a better idea of how much you will get from a bank or lender.

Although these calculators are very accurate, what they say isn't set in stone. It is only an estimate or a quote. To know for sure how much you will get from a lender, you should apply for a loan. Before you do, you should do the relevant search and research to make sure that the bank you're working with is a good one. Not all of these banks have good interest rates or terms, so it may take you a little while to find the right one. Still, with the help of the free home improvement loans quotes, you will have a much better idea of what to expect.

Once you have applied for and have been approved for a home improvement loan, you are ready to begin your planning process. Be sure to leave some of the loan amount as a buffer. Often contractors and home owners underestimate how much construction will cost, especially on big projects. Protect yourself by saving a bit of money aside that can help you just in case you go over budget.

As you can see, free home improvement loans quote calculators are a very important part of the planning process. They are great because they can be used to know just about how much you can spend on your project. And it doesn't matter what that project is. You could be refacing your cabinets, installing a new bathtub, or adding a completely new roof. Whatever the case may be, these calculators are definitely helpful.
